UN commissioner warns: unregulated artificial intelligence threatens global catastrophe

New Delhi, Feb.21 (SANA) United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ights Volker Türk has warned of the serious dangers posed by unregulated artificial intelligence, cautioning that it could slip beyond the control of its developers if they lack a deep understanding of ethical and social principles.

In an interview with UN News during the AI Impact Summit in New Delhi, India, Türk compared the situation to “Frankenstein’s monster,” saying developers may create something they are later unable to control. Without full awareness of the risks, he warned, AI could cause widespread disruption.

Türk stressed the urgent need for clear regulatory frameworks and called for mandatory human rights impact assessments for AI technologies, similar to safety requirements in the pharmaceutical industry, at the stages of design, deployment, and marketing.

His remarks follow the International AI Safety Report 2026, issued on February 3, which noted that AI systems could influence people’s ability to make informed decisions and act upon them.
